package main import ( "fmt" "crypto/md5" "io/ioutil" "log" "os" "path/filepath" "sort" "time" ) type fileData struct { filePath string info os.FileInfo } type hash [16]byte func check(err error) { if err != nil { log.Fatal(err) } } func checksum(filePath string) hash { bytes, err := ioutil.ReadFile(filePath) check(err) return hash(md5.Sum(bytes)) } func findDuplicates(dirPath string, minSize int64) [][2]fileData { var dups [][2]fileData m := make(map[hash]fileData) werr := filepath.Walk(dirPath, func(path string, info os.FileInfo, err error) error { if err != nil { return err } if !info.IsDir() && info.Size() >= minSize { h := checksum(path) fd, ok := m[h] fd2 := fileData{path, info} if !ok { m[h] = fd2 } else { dups = append(dups, [2]fileData{fd, fd2}) } } return nil }) check(werr) return dups } func main() { dups := findDuplicates(".", 1) fmt.Println("The following pairs of files have the same size and the same hash:\n") fmt.Println("File name Size Date last modified") fmt.Println("==========================================================") sort.Slice(dups, func(i, j int) bool { return dups[i][0].info.Size() > dups[j][0].info.Size() // in order of decreasing size }) for _, dup := range dups { for i := 0; i < 2; i++ { d := dup[i] fmt.Printf("%-20s %8d %v\n", d.filePath, d.info.Size(), d.info.ModTime().Format(time.ANSIC)) } fmt.Println() } }
